Usage examples of "admit" in English with translation to Spanish

<>
Few politicians admit their mistakes. Pocos políticos admiten sus errores.
I admit it. I was wrong. Lo reconozco, me equivoqué.
I admit that, without him, those ten years of my life would have been empty and without goals. Confieso que, sin él, esos diez años de mi vida estarían vacíos y sin objetivos.
I admit I'm wrong. Admito que estoy equivocado.
She doesn't admit that she is wrong. Ella no reconoce que está equivocada.
These facts admit of no contradiction. Estos hechos no admiten discusión.
He was scared to admit that he didn't know. Él tenía miedo de reconocer que no lo sabía.
He will never admit his fault. Ella jamás admitirá su error.
I admit that the average Chilean is quite a cheater. Reconozco que el chileno promedio es bien tramposo.
I admit it to be true. Admito que eso es verdad.
I admit, I'm not the tidiest person in the world. Lo reconozco, no soy la persona más ordenada del mundo.
I must admit that I snore. Debo admitir que ronco...
I admit that I was careless. Admito haber sido negligente.
I admit that he is right. Admito que tiene razón.
I'll admit I'm wrong. Admitiré que estoy equivocado.
You are honest to admit your mistake. Eres honesto como para admitir tu error.
Did he admit that he was wrong? ¿Él admitió que estaba equivocado?
I must admit that I was mistaken. Debo admitir que estuve equivocado.
Why don't you admit your mistake? ¿Por qué no admites tu error?
He was not about to admit his mistake. No fue capaz de admitir su error.
